Why Beading Corners Matter
When you’re beading—whether stringing pearls, adding decorative elements, or constructing wearable art—corners are often the weak points in your design. Uneven angles, loose stitches, or crooked finishes can undermine even the most beautiful work. But with the right beading corner technique, you can enhance structural integrity, achieve a polished look, and impress clients or friends with flawless results every time.

Use Corner Bead Kits or Precision Tools
Invest in a dedicated corner bead tool or a set of specialized beading pliers. These tools create tight, consistent bends that stabilize your stitches and keep corners crisp. Brands like Sig(San Seido) and Beadalon offer ergonomic, accuracy-focused tools perfect for sharp corners. -
Cut Your Strands with Sharp Precision
A clean, sharp cut is the foundation of good corners. Use a rotary cutter or French scissors to ensure smooth, even ends—no frayed fibers or uneven lengths disrupt symmetry. -
Master the Corner Stitch Technique
For fabric or bead-wrapped bases, pivot your thread at a 90-degree angle using a false back knot or crimp bead, then secure with a hidden knot or stitch. Alternating thread direction at corners prevents puckering and ensures durability. -
Check Alignment Often
Use a ruler or angle guide against your workspace to keep corners square. A simple 45-degree angle mark can keep every bead aligned like a polished frame. -
Practice with Kernels and Test Squares
Before working on your final piece, craft a small square using scrap materials. Focus solely on corner accuracy, tension, and symmetry—this builds muscle memory and confidence.

Quick Tips to Speed Up Your Edge Work
- Prepare Tools the Night Before: Have your pliers sharpened, threaded, and bead-prepped ready to minimize setup time.
- Work in Short Bursts: Target corners in focused intervals to maintain precision without fatigue.
- Use Beading Boards or Markers: Visual aids keep your layout straight and corners consistent.
- Secure Threads Early: Apply a small knot or crimp bead immediately after completing a corner to lock position instantly.
